Reasons to consider Intel Core i5-2300

None

Reasons to consider Intel Core i3-4370

Much higher single threaded performance (around 46% higher), makes a noticeable performance difference in gaming and the majority of applications.
41 watts lower power draw.
This is a newer product, it might have better application compatibility/performance (check features chart below).
Around 22% higher average synthetic performance.

Architecture

Intel Core i5-2300Intel Core i3-4370
ArchitectureIntel_SandyBridgevsIntel_Haswell
MarketDesktopvsDesktop
Memory SupportDDR3vsDDR3
CodenameSandy BridgevsHaswell
Release DateJan 2011vsJul 2014

Cores

Intel Core i5-2300Intel Core i3-4370
Cores4vs2
Threads4vs4
SMPs1vs1
Integrated GraphicsIntel HD 2000vsIntel HD 4600

Cache

Intel Core i5-2300Intel Core i3-4370
L1 Cache64 KB (per core)vs64 KB (per core)
L2 Cache256 KB (per core)vs256 KB (per core)
L3 Cache6144 KB (shared)vs4096 KB (shared)

Physical

Intel Core i5-2300Intel Core i3-4370
SocketIntel Socket 1155vsIntel Socket 1150
Max Case Tempunknownvs72°C
PackageFC-LGA10vsFC-LGA12C
Die Size216mm²vs177mm²
Process32 nmvs22 nm

Performance

Intel Core i5-2300Intel Core i3-4370
Cpu Frequency2800 MHzvs3800 MHz
Turbo Clock3100 MHzvsnone
Base Clock100 MHzvs100 MHz
Voltageunknownvsunknown
TDP95 Wvs54 W
